Tips for Successfully Staging and Selling Your Lakefront Home

Selling a lakefront home requires a strategic approach to showcase its unique features and maximize its market value. From staging the property to targeting the right audience, the steps you take can make all the difference in a successful sale. Here are key tips to help you prepare your lakefront home for the market and ensure it stands out among other homes for sale in Orlando.

Highlight the Waterfront Lifestyle

The defining feature of your lakefront home is its access to the water. Emphasize this unique aspect to potential buyers by creating a lifestyle-focused presentation. Stage outdoor spaces to demonstrate how the waterfront can be enjoyed. Arrange patio furniture to suggest a relaxing retreat, add tasteful decor to a dock or boathouse, and include elements that highlight recreational opportunities like kayaking, fishing, or paddleboarding.

Ensure the lakefront view is a focal point during showings by removing obstructions like overgrown plants or heavy curtains. Clean windows thoroughly and consider adding outdoor lighting to enhance the ambiance during evening tours.

Stage the Interior with a Focus on Natural Light

The interior of your lakefront home should complement its outdoor appeal. Highlight natural light by keeping windows uncovered and using mirrors to reflect the brightness. Arrange furniture to maximize the sense of space and create a flow that leads buyers toward the best views of the lake.

Use a neutral color palette to appeal to a broad range of buyers, allowing them to envision their own style in the space. Incorporate subtle, tasteful nods to the waterfront lifestyle, such as nautical decor, to tie the interior theme to the home’s unique location.

Pay Attention to Curb Appeal

First impressions matter, especially for lakefront properties. The exterior of your home should reflect its premium appeal. Power wash the driveway, clean the siding, and refresh landscaping with vibrant, seasonal plants.

Special attention should be given to the shoreline. Remove any debris, maintain a clear pathway to the lake, and ensure that docks or piers are clean and in good condition. Buyers often imagine themselves enjoying the water’s edge, so a well-maintained shoreline can be a major selling point.

Showcase the Home’s Unique Features

Lakefront homes often come with features that set them apart from other properties. Highlight these elements to create a sense of exclusivity. Features like private docks, boathouses, panoramic windows, and outdoor entertainment areas should be prominently showcased during tours.

If your home includes amenities like a fire pit, swimming area, or outdoor kitchen, stage these areas to help buyers envision their use. Any upgrades, such as a recently renovated kitchen or modernized HVAC system, should also be emphasized to add perceived value.

Focus on Professional Photography and Marketing

High-quality photography is critical for lakefront homes. Professional photographers can capture the beauty of your property, emphasizing its water views and scenic surroundings. Aerial drone shots can showcase the property’s relationship to the lake, offering a perspective that sets it apart from other homes for sale in Orlando.

Complement these visuals with a compelling listing description that highlights the home’s key features, the benefits of lakefront living, and its proximity to Orlando’s amenities. A well-crafted marketing plan, including social media promotion and virtual tours, can help you reach a larger pool of potential buyers.

Price Your Home Strategically

Pricing a lakefront home requires careful analysis of the local market. Consider factors such as the property’s location, the quality of lake access, the condition of the home, and comparable sales in the area. Pricing too high may deter buyers, while pricing too low can leave money on the table.

Consult with a real estate professional experienced in selling lakefront properties to determine an appropriate price point. A well-priced home will generate interest and may lead to multiple offers, increasing the likelihood of a successful sale.

Address Maintenance and Repairs

Buyers are often wary of maintenance issues in waterfront homes due to the unique challenges posed by proximity to water. Proactively address any necessary repairs before listing the property. Inspect areas prone to wear and tear, such as the roof, siding, and windows, for signs of damage.

Ensure the dock, if present, is in good condition and adheres to local regulations. Any small improvements, like updating fixtures or repainting walls, can also go a long way in making the home more appealing to buyers.

Appeal to a Targeted Audience

Understanding the likely buyers for your lakefront home can help tailor your marketing strategy. These buyers may range from retirees seeking a serene retreat to families looking for recreational opportunities or professionals desiring a balance of nature and city life.

Highlight the benefits of the location, such as proximity to Orlando’s top attractions, schools, and entertainment venues. Focus on how the lakefront lifestyle enhances everyday living, creating an aspirational appeal for prospective buyers.

Be Flexible and Ready to Showcase

Flexibility is essential when selling a lakefront property. Potential buyers may wish to see the home at different times to experience the view during various hours of the day. Be prepared to accommodate these requests and ensure the home is always in show-ready condition.

Additionally, hosting open houses or special events, such as sunset tours or lakefront gatherings, can help buyers experience the property’s unique features firsthand.
